Send Help is one of those films you should walk into with the right mindset. If you’re expecting a story that makes perfect sense, you might end up frustrated. But if you’re there to be entertained, it actually works really well.
Directed by Sam Raimi, known for films like Spider-Man and Drag Me to Hell, this movie blends a bit of everything - thriller, drama, romance, horror and comedy. It is messy in parts, but that’s also where the fun comes in.
What stood out most for me was the humour. It’s not loud or obvious. In fact, it’s quite subtle and sometimes comes in sideways. There were moments that were genuinely funny, but many people in the cinema didn’t seem to catch them. It’s very much a backhanded kind of comedy. You either get it, or you don’t.
The story itself is quite unrealistic. A lot of things that happen feel unlikely, and if you start questioning the logic, you’ll probably find many flaws. But honestly, this is not a film you’re supposed to analyse too deeply. It’s better to just go along with it and enjoy the ride.
Rachel McAdams was excellent. She really carried the film and brought a lot of life into her character. You can tell she was fully committed, and it shows in her performance.
The boss, played by Dylan O'Brien, was good too. He played his role well, though it did feel like he wasn’t quite a match for McAdams’ energy on screen.
Overall, Raimi did a good job with the direction. The film feels unpredictable and a bit chaotic, but in a way that keeps you watching. You never quite know what’s coming next.
In the end, don’t look for perfection here. Just sit back and enjoy it for what it is.
Rating: 7/10
